Description:

Under general supervision, provides nursing care in a hospital to a variety of patients with health problems ranging from simple to complex. Assumes responsibility for an assigned group of patients. Documents patient responses to nursing interventions and prescribed medical treatments. Notes all changes in physician orders on assigned patients. Assists physicians in the examination of patients and in performing minor diagnostic procedures and treatments.

Obtains and monitors physiological data of patients, observes physiological manifestations, and intervenes when necessary. Administers medication as prescribed. Initiates, regulates, and monitors intravenous infusions and blood products. Delivers patient care competently. Interacts with family and patients in sharing care plans while in the hospital and during discharge. Informs patients and families of hospital procedures. Makes referrals regarding patient care needs to appropriate personnel.

Delegates tasks to support staff. Performs other duties as assigned. The unit cares for post-surgical kidney, liver, and pancreas transplant patients. Patients require close monitoring for infection, rejection, and timely medication delivery. This is not a PACU position. Nurses will either work on the medical/surgical or stepdown unit, depending on the availability of staff. Preceptor and charge experience preferred.
